Q. What is PCB substrate made of?

The substrate most commonly used in printed circuit boards is a glass fiber reinforced (fiberglass) epoxy resin with a copper foil bonded on to one or both sides. PCBs made from paper reinforced phenolic resin with a bonded copper foil are less expensive and are often used in household electrical devices.

Silkscreen Layers include Top Overlay and Bottom Overlay. It is used to place the text information like the components profile, the numbers of components. 6. Other Layers. Keep-Out Layer is used to define the area of printed circuit board.

Q. What are PCB layers?

As explained under point 4, the PCB is defined as a number of copper layers in a well defined sequence. Copper layers of a PCB are usually just named layers or also called SIGNAL layer. However to define the complete PCB, other layers are required. They are usually named by their functionality and position.

Q. What is 2 layer PCB?

2 layers PCB has more layers than a 1 layer PCB but fewer than a multilayer PCB. 2 layers PCB can mount conductive copper and components on both sides of the printed circuit board so that the traces can cross over each other. So it leads to a higher density of boards without the need of point-to-point soldering.

Q. Do electrical engineers use CAD?

Electrical engineers design, develop and test the manufacturing of electrical equipment. CAD enables these engineers to create electrical and electronic diagrams, control circuit diagrams, schematics and documentation.
